OverviewShowcases 57 key selected works from a prodigious career spanning nearly six decades of output This stunning monograph showcases 57 specially selected works from Cheng Taining's illustrious career, which spans nearly 60 years. His portfolio extends to more than 150 projects, many of which have won prizes and significant acclaim, such as the Beijing Great Hall of People and the Bridge Tower of Nanjing Yangtze River Bridge. Richly illustrated throughout, the works are grouped under three key themes: ""Boundaries"", ""Artistic Conception"", and ""Language"", and provide a vivid articulation of Cheng Taining's creativity and leadership. Recently Cheng Taining headed the research for 'The Present and Future of Architectural Design in Contemporary China and Research of Policy Measures to Improve Architectural Design,' which are highly regarded as significant contributions to the development of Chinese architectural design and policy strategy. Cheng has published five collections of 'Cheng Taining's Architectural Works;' his work has also featured in documentaries, essays, and anthologies. This book adds to that incredible canon.
